Analyzing your bundle size

We covered build budgets and how they can help keep your application performant by detecting when a new dependency dramatically increases the size of your build output.

If you want to look at your build bundle and determine which dependency/module is the biggest, there’s another tool at your disposal: The Webpack Bundle Analyzer.

To install it, use the following npm command:

npm install --save-dev webpack-bundle-analyzer

Then, run your Angular build with the option that generates build statistics:

ng build --stats-json

Finally, run the Webpack Bundle Analyzer to read those build stats and give you a visual output of that bundle:

npx webpack-bundle-analyzer dist/stats.json

This command opens a new tab in your browser with the following user interface. Each rectangle represents a Javascript module. The bigger the rectangle, the bigger the module.

In the above example, we can see that the application code (main.js – in green color) is a lot smaller than the application dependencies.

For instance, we could improve this project by removing polyfills.js, as these polyfills were included to maintain compatibility with the now-retired Internet Explorer, and they take more space than our application code!
